  1&1 Dedicated Servers Any Good?

Just wondering if anyone uses 1&1's dedicated server packages and whether they are any good? Looking for a new dedicated server to add to the collection and was considering 1&1. I have some shared hosting with them and alot of domain names just thought it might be worth giving their dedicated servers a bash. Plus they offering unlimited bandwidth with signups at present.

I believe the servers are in Germany. That means that Google might well think your site is in Germany by its IP address. Great for targetting Germans - not so good for UK customers.

I have a client had 2 1&1 servers - Linux in Germany, Win in US. The German one suffered several hardware faults over a period of 2 weeks or so and the support was non existent - suffice to say all PHP/MySQL sites now run on the Windows box in the States and we are dropping the other one. The US one has been good when issues have arisen as the support staff have been a lot better.

Best service used so far is Clara Net (docklands) - but that is co-lo of own box.
